Description

n-Acetyl-L-Citrulline is a chemically modified derivative of the amino acid L-citrulline, designed for enhanced stability and bioavailability. This acetylated form is critical for applications requiring precise metabolic precursors and intermediates in biochemical synthesis. It serves as a key raw material for research and production in the pharmaceutical, nutraceutical, and advanced biochemical sectors, where consistent quality and reliable supply are paramount.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ediates: Used in the synthesis of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and drug candidates targeting nitric oxide pathways and cardiovascular health.
  • Dietary Supplement & Nutraceutical Formulations: Incorporated as a stable, bioavailable precursor to L-arginine and nitric oxide in performance and wellness supplements.
  • Biochemical Research: Serves as a critical reagent and standard in metabolic studies, enzymatic assays, and cell culture media for investigating urea cycle dynamics.
  • Cosmeceutical Ingredients: Utilized in advanced skincare formulations for its potential role in promoting circulation and skin health.
  • Veterinary Medicine: Applied in specialized animal health products and nutritional supplements.

Basic Information

Product Name n-Acetyl-L-Citrulline
CAS No. 33965-42-3
Molecular Formula C8H15N3O4
Molecular Weight 217.22 g/mol
Synonyms Nα-Acetyl-L-citrulline; N-Acetylcitrulline; L-Nα-Acetylcitrulline; (2S)-2-Acetamido-5-(carbamoylamino)pentanoic acid; Acetylcitrulline; N-Acetyl-L-citrulline; Ac-Cit-OH

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area at a controlled room temperature (15-25°C). Due to its hygroscopic nature, the container must be kept tightly sealed after opening to minimize exposure to moisture.

Specification

Item Specification
Appearance White to off-white crystalline powder
Identification (IR) Conforms to reference spectrum
Assay (HPLC) ≥ 98.0%
Optical Rotation [α]D20 +18.0° to +22.0° (c=1 in H2O)
Loss on Drying ≤ 1.0%
Residue on Ignition ≤ 0.1%
Heavy Metals (as Pb) ≤ 10 ppm
Related Substances (HPLC) Total impurities ≤ 2.0%
